Anxiety

Anxiety or nervousness can be described as any feeling of worry or being dreaded usually about events or circumstances that may potentially happen. This feeling can be normal after some stressful circumstances or events but it should be taken very much under consideration when it interferes with the person’s ability to function.

A person facing a clear and present danger is not usually considered to be in a state of anxiety.

Symptoms

The commonly seen symptoms are fatigue, insomnia; sometimes stomach upset, rapid breathing or shortness of breath and irritability.

A large number of physical changes take place when a person is under anxiety or stress. the brain and nervous system become intensely active; the pupils of the eye dilate; digestion slows down; muscle become tense; heart starts pumping blood harder and faster; blood pressure increases; breathing becomes faster; hormones such as adrenaline are released into the system along with glucose from the liver and sweating starts. All these changes take place in a split second under the direction of the nervous system.

If the stress factors are removed immediately, no harm accrues and all the changes are reversed. Stress in its earlier and reversible stage leads to poor sleep, bad temper, continual grumbling, domestic conflict, repeated minor sickness, a feeling of frustration and increase in alcohol intake.

Stress may be caused by a variety of factors outside the body and within. External factors include loud noises, blinding lights, extreme heat or cold, X-rays and other forms of radiation, drugs, chemicals, bacterial and various toxic substances, pain and inadequate nutrition. The factors from within the body include hate, envy, fear or jealousy.
